LGV Class 1 ADR Tanker Driver – Cryogenic Gases
Margam, United Kingdom | req22664
What you will enjoy doing:
* You will deliver products to internal and external customers.
* You will be in charge of filling and analysing own tankers and high-pressure trailers.
* Coupling and uncoupling of motive units/towing vehicles from tankers/trailers is part of this role.
* Taking part in campaigns from time to time to support the company’s service.
* You will occasionally be working away from your base.
* Various shift arrangements will be available due to 24/7/365 business operation.
What makes you great:
* You have a high level of safety awareness.
* At least two years of having a driving license class C + E (LGV).
* A possession of a DCPC is essential.
* Ability to demonstrate experience of tanker driving is required.
* You must have an ADR Class 2 licence in tanks as well as a good understanding of EU and WTD tachograph legislation.
* You are able to work as part of a team.
* You have a high level of personal integrity.
